Boosting Mining Rubber Chain Lifespan

To achieve the greatest performance from your mining tire chains, a considered maintenance strategy is absolutely essential. Periodic inspections for wear, such as broken links or noticeable stretching, are key. Furthermore, maintaining the correct link tension is necessary; too firm a tension can cause in premature failure, while too click here slack a tension can reduce traction and effectiveness. Proper lubrication, using a specialized chain lubricant, also has a important role in reducing friction and preventing corrosion. Finally, consider matching the link type to the particular operating conditions and load to maximize longevity and minimize replacement outlays. A mix of these practices will considerably extend the usable life of your mining wheel chains.

Protecting Extraction {Tires: A Heavy-Duty Wear Protection Approach

The relentless environment of quarrying operations subjects tires to extreme damage, necessitating specialized protection strategies. Traditional tire maintenance often proves insufficient against the constant barrage of sharp rocks, abrasive materials, and heavy weights. To combat this, a layered approach encompassing advanced tire compounds, innovative tread structures, and potentially incorporating protection systems like bolted casings or foam filling is crucial. This robust methodology aims to significantly extend tire lifespan, reduce downtime, and ultimately enhance overall production output within the mining sector. Consider also the impact of underinflation – a major contributor to tire malfunction – and implement rigorous pressure monitoring programs.
